About The Role

As a Bilingual Receptionist, you will serve as the first point of contact for employees, clients, visitors, and guests. You will provide professional reception and workplace support services in both English and French , helping ensure the day-to-day operation of the workplace runs smoothly and efficiently.

We are currently seeking a professional and service-oriented Bilingual Receptionist to join our team in Montreal.

Key Responsibilities

  • Provide professional and welcoming reception services in both English and French.
  • Greet and assist employees, clients, visitors, and guests in a professional and courteous manner.
  • Answer and direct incoming calls and respond to inquiries in both official languages.
  • Coordinate incoming and outgoing mail and courier services, including collection, sorting, dispatch, and distribution.
  • Support pantry service delivery, ensuring pantry areas are organized, clean, and adequately stocked.
  • Manage office supplies, including monitoring inventory, placing orders, receiving supplies, and maintaining organized storage areas.
  • Support meeting room management, including coordinating room bookings, preparing meeting spaces, and ensuring rooms are ready for use.
  • Assist with general administrative and workplace service requests.
  • Maintain accurate records and follow established workplace procedures and service standards.
  • Work closely with the client and internal teams to provide a high level of customer service.
  • Maintain confidentiality and professionalism when handling sensitive information.
  • Perform other related duties as assigned.
